No 5 Singari Bagan
No 5 Singari Bagan is a village located in Dhekiajuli subdivision of Sonitpur district in Assam, India. It is situated 13km away from sub-district headquarter Dhekiajuli (tehsildar office) and 49km away from district headquarter Tezpur. As per 2009 stats, Pirakata is the gram panchayat of No 5 Singari Bagan village.

About No 5 Singari Bagan
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of No 5 Singari Bagan is 285817. The village spans a total geographical area of 205.72 hectares. Dhekiajuli is nearest town to No 5 Singari Bagan village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 13km away.

Population of No 5 Singari Bagan
Below is a concise population overview of No 5 Singari Bagan as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 2,054 | 1,052 | 1,002 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 272 | 152 | 120 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 26 | 16 | 10 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 8 | 4 | 4 |
Literate Population | 995 | 601 | 394 |
Illiterate Population | 1,059 | 451 | 608 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of No 5 Singari Bagan village:
- The total population of No 5 Singari Bagan village is around 2,054, including approximately 1,052 males and 1,002 females, with a sex ratio of 952 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 272 children aged 0–6 years in No 5 Singari Bagan village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- No 5 Singari Bagan village has 26 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 8 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of No 5 Singari Bagan village is about 48.44%, with male literacy at 57.13% and female literacy at 39.32%.
- There are around 404 households in No 5 Singari Bagan village.
Connectivity of No 5 Singari Bagan
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like No 5 Singari Bagan. As per the 2011 stats, No 5 Singari Bagan had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
